a/c and idling?

when i start the car while engine is still cold and the a/c is off ..it starts right up but then the a/c pulley activates after a minute then the car begins to idle up and down..does that for a minute then the pulley stops and the up and down idling stop but as the car heats up the idling up and down thing stop but the pulley continues to go off and on it never stops but when i turn the a/c on the pulley stays on..whats going on here???

Either your AC clutch idler bearing is locking up or the HVAC coneols are cycling the compressor on and off. Remove the electrical connector from the clutch to see if the phenomenon still occurs.
